Mineral Processing System Architecture
Conditioning Capacity as the Basis for Adaptation
Adaptation begins with how much variability the circuit was designed to absorb. Adaptive Conditioning Capacity forms through buffer volumes, adjustable operating ranges, and permissive interface geometry. When this capacity exists, ore change expresses as controlled adjustment; when absent, it manifests as stress accumulation masked by short-term correction.
Elasticity of Response to Ore Variation
Ore-Driven Response Elasticity reflects how smoothly recovery, energy demand, and residence time adjust as mineralogy, hardness, or texture evolve. Elastic response disperses deviation across stages; inelastic response concentrates it locally. Elasticity depends less on control sophistication than on whether physical and hydraulic margins remain available.

Exhaustion of Adaptation and Validation
Incremental feed change can silently consume flexibility. Validation Of Adaptation Exhaustion requires comparing performance sensitivity across matched ore states rather than tracking averages. Periodic validation reveals when additional adjustment yields diminishing stability, indicating that adaptive capacity has been spent.

Coherence of Adjustment Across Circuits
Cross-Circuit Adjustment Coherence depends on aligned expectations between preparation, separation, and tailings handling. Isolated tuning—hardening one stage to protect another—relocates deviation instead of accommodating change. Coherence holds when adjustment intent binds interfaces and sequences consistently.
